当前位置:首页 > 科技动态 > 正文

网络传输数据是什么进制

网络传输数据是什么进制

网络传输数据进制揭秘:了解数据传输的底层进制系统在网络通信的世界里,数据传输的进制系统是基础中的基础。那么,网络传输数据究竟使用的是哪种进制呢?以下是关于网络传输数据进...

网络传输数据进制揭秘:了解数据传输的底层进制系统

在网络通信的世界里,数据传输的进制系统是基础中的基础。那么,网络传输数据究竟使用的是哪种进制呢?以下是关于网络传输数据进制的一些常见问题及其解答,帮助您深入了解这一关键概念。

常见问题解答

问题1:网络传输数据主要使用哪种进制?

网络传输数据主要使用二进制(Binary)进制。二进制是计算机科学的基础,它使用两个数字符号“0”和“1”来表示所有的数据。在二进制中,每一位(bit)只能表示两种状态,这使得计算机能够通过简单的电子开关来处理和存储信息。在数据传输过程中,所有的信息都会被转换为二进制格式,然后通过电信号或光信号进行传输。

问题2:为什么网络传输使用二进制而不是十进制?

二进制之所以被用于网络传输,是因为它的简洁性和易于处理。计算机内部的所有操作都是基于电子开关的,而电子开关只有两种状态,即“开”和“关”,这正好对应二进制的“0”和“1”。二进制系统的设计使得计算机能够以极高的速度进行数据处理,这对于网络传输来说至关重要。相比之下,十进制虽然更符合人类的计数习惯,但在电子设备中实现起来更为复杂。

问题3:二进制数据如何转换为其他进制形式?

二进制数据转换为其他进制(如十进制、十六进制等)通常通过位运算和数值转换来实现。例如,将二进制转换为十进制,可以通过将每个二进制位乘以其对应的权重(从右至左,从0开始,每个位向左移动一位,权重翻倍),然后将所有结果相加得到十进制数。转换到十六进制时,通常每四位二进制数对应一个十六进制数,通过查找二进制到十六进制的转换表来完成。

最新文章